Audio Technica and Digital Reference wireless

Just noticed that the DR 3000 series appears to be an exact copy of a AT2000 series, even in the same frequency range. I've heard that DR is owned by AT. Is it possible that these are the same unit?

There are indeed off-branding of AT products such as their pro 88 video wireless but there are significant differences in seemingly identical models if you look closely. These are usually responsible for the price differences. Buyer beware.

Digital Reference used to be an Audio Technica brand, but it is now owned by Guitar Center. I suspect that DR products are still made by AT and sold exclusively through GC, but I could be wrong.

I've worked for a company that did some re-brandng in the past. Sometimes these are nothing more than the same unit with a different name, sometimes they are designed to meet very different spec's (some better, come cheaper). Like Aged said, "buyer beware".

And personally, I never trust any "sold exclusively by XYZ..." products.
